| Aspect | Health Care Receptionist | Medical Secretary |
|---|
| Credentials | High school diploma or equivalent; some roles may require certification | High school diploma; medical office certification preferred |
| Work Environment | Front desk of clinics, hospitals, or healthcare offices | Medical offices, hospitals, or clinics, often handling administrative tasks |
| Primary Responsibilities | Greeting patients, scheduling appointments, answering phones | Managing correspondence, preparing reports, scheduling, and administrative support |
While both roles work in healthcare settings and require strong communication skills, the Health Care Receptionist primarily handles front desk duties and patient interactions, whereas the Medical Secretary focuses more on administrative support and documentation.
